This exhibition will be the culmination of four months of work by artists who have scavenged materials from the dump to make art and promote recycling and reuse.

Benjamin Cowden, “Lunar Cassowaries.”

 Mechanical sculptures that explore flight and wind propulsion through the combination of unusual materials.

Ian Treasure "Road to Nowhere." Kinetic sculptures that present opportunities to reflect on the complexities and absurdities of life.

Hannah Quinn, "Beyond the Bower." Functional works that reference the traditions of craftspeople and home hobbyists, while also exploring the utilitarian forms for stools, benches and ladders.
